One Platform, Three Levels of the Same Territory

In Vietnam the distributor (nhà phân phối) employs the salesman team, while the brand employs the Sales Supervisor and Area Sales Manager layer above it. 1Channel gives each level the view it needs, and joins the dealer counter, the project site and the installer crew into a single record per territory.

Territory Design for Clusters and Provinces

An urban construction belt and a provincial route need opposite call patterns: a dense day of short stops against a long drive with few, high-value calls. Journey plans are set per territory across the North, the Centre and the South, and a Sales Supervisor can rebalance a beat as clusters grow or cool.

Dealer Calls and Stock Checks on Bulky Lines

Heavy goods sit in a yard, not on a shelf, so the check is pallet and bundle counts, shade or batch codes, damaged stock and slow movers. The visit form records each one with a photo, and the reorder prompt follows what that dealer actually turns.

Projects, Specification and the Installer Tier

A site call records the build stage, the quantity still to buy, the contractor and the crew applying the product. Fed into the analytics layer, that tells an Area Sales Manager which projects are moving, which specifications have slipped, and where installer preference is quietly switching brands.

Attendance That Fits a Site Day

Check-in is geo-fenced to the dealer premises, the project site or the distributor depot, with a selfie check against proxy marking. A Monday to Friday plan with Saturday-morning trade calls is normal here, and the workforce view shows adherence without anyone chasing an update.

Specification to Delivery, Tracked

Each project holds its stage, decision-maker, open quantity and VND value. A slipped milestone raises a flag instead of ageing quietly, and route planning pulls the next site call forward when a build reaches the stage that consumes your line.

Quotations and Orders for Heavy Deliveries

Reps quote at the counter or on site against live stock in the distributor system, with slab pricing, scheme eligibility, credit position and a delivery date the yard can meet. Part deliveries stay linked to the order they came from.

Expense, Leave, Timesheets

Long provincial drives make travel the biggest line in a building materials field budget. Expense claims attach to the visit that justified them, receipts included, and approvals run by policy rather than by memory. Leave management covers Vietnamese public holidays and the Tết shutdown, and timesheets export payroll-ready.
